Accurate Models of AMD Matrix Cores
Matrix multipliers on recent GPUs don't follow IEEE 754, and their undocumented quirks—accumulator width, rounding, subnormal handling—make results irreproducible across devices. Researchers characterize AMD's CDNA 1, CDNA 2, and CDNA 3 matrix cores using targeted test vectors, then build MATLAB models that match hardware bit-for-bit across 10 million random inputs. They also quantify application-level accuracy differences between AMD matrix cores and NVIDIA tensor cores.
As a result, reproducibility of small matrix multiplier results across devices is not possible and cannot be achieved by software control.
